Figure 3. Cytokine/chemokine mRNA expression in the lungs of vaccinated mice is rapidly up-regulated following i.t. challenge with F. tularensis LVS.

Groups of control (solid bar) and vaccinated (open bar) mice were infected i.t. with 6 LD50 F. tularensis LVS. The lungs were dissected at 4 hours and 3 days post-infection; cytokine and chemokine mRNA expression was quantified by real-time RT-PCR. Data are the means ± SD derived from 4 mice treated comparably. A second experiment yielded similar results. *Vaccinated group is significantly different from control: P<0.05.
